vala.bbclass: add dependency on vala
This class points the inheritor, if it is a target, to directories in the target sysroot, so we want to be sure the .vapi files are there. (From OE-Core master rev: 2da8bbd47686f54efeec521d521f176f6aeb8d39) (From OE-Core rev: e68307c3fb0a02efe5e0789a58686f343c842707) Signed-off-by: Joe Slater <jslater@windriver.com> Signed-off-by: Saul Wold <sgw@linux.intel.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org> Signed-off-by: Robert Yang <liezhi.yang@windriver.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
This commit is contained in:
parent
11d9127ac5
commit
9134463e4d
|
@ -1,9 +1,12 @@
|
|||
# Vala has problems with multiple concurrent invocations
|
||||
PARALLEL_MAKE = ""
|
||||
|
||||
# Vala needs vala-native
|
||||
DEPENDS += "vala-native"
|
||||
DEPENDS_virtclass-native += "vala-native"
|
||||
# Everyone needs vala-native and targets need vala, too,
|
||||
# because that is where target builds look for .vapi files.
|
||||
#
|
||||
VALADEPENDS = ""
|
||||
VALADEPENDS_class-target = "vala"
|
||||
DEPENDS_append = " vala-native ${VALADEPENDS}"
|
||||
|
||||
# Our patched version of Vala looks in STAGING_DATADIR for .vapi files
|
||||
export STAGING_DATADIR
|
||||
|
|
Loading…
Reference in New Issue